Racing Santander: A Leader with Wobbly Form

Racing Santander sits top of the Segunda División with 59 points, a healthy lead, but their recent form is anything but stable. Just days before hosting Sporting Gijon, they lost 0-2 to Zaragoza and were stunned 0-4 by Albacete at home. These losses have raised eyebrows about their robustness as league leaders.

Despite their impressive tally of 62 goals scored this season, Racing's defense has looked porous, conceding 46 goals. Interestingly, they have managed only 7 clean sheets, which underlines their vulnerability at the back. Their last five matches reflect this inconsistency — two wins, two losses, and a draw.

Sporting Gijon: Seeking Stability

Sporting Gijon, currently 10th with 46 points, has shown flashes of brilliance but lack consistency. They've scored 43 goals but have a slightly better defensive record than Racing, conceding 40 goals. With more clean sheets (9) compared to their upcoming opponents, they will be looking to exploit Racing’s defensive lapses.

Gijon’s recent form paints a story of mixed fortunes. They managed a 1-1 draw against Deportivo La Coruna and a solid 4-1 win over Castellón, but losses to Las Palmas and FC Andorra hint at their struggle to maintain form.

Head-to-Head Dynamics

Racing and Gijon's recent head-to-head record favors the former. Racing has won 6 out of their last 10 encounters. Notably, the last time they met at El Sardinero, Racing triumphed 2-0. Gijon’s last victory over Racing was back in October 2025, a narrow 2-1 win at home.
